Chicken Shepherd

A new puppy brings so many new photo opps. Only one of her ears has straightened up so far, but it can take 4 to 6 months.

Today I took her out to the pasture with me to feed the 3 1/2 week old broiler chicks. When I set the first feeders out and birds started flocking to them, Abbie realized where they were supposed to be and started herding the stragglers over to the feeders. I only had to tell her once to stop herding them once they were at the feeders. Then she sat and watched them eat, and if one would wander away she would herd it back. So cute, and only 9 weeks old!
